Scheme Of Graduate
Level Examination :
According to autonomous scheme Holkar
science college organizes its on examinations. for theory of every subject 30%
marks are for internal test and 70% marks are for main examination. The
internal test programme is declared from time to time to the students It is
compulsory to pass the Theory and practical examination separately.
At least 33% marks in theory main
examination and in theory main examination and internal test 33% marks jointly
are required to declare pass.
In practical examination 33% will
be pass marks.
-
The assessment of
division :- The division of B.Sc. Will be decided after passing the
third year of the B.Sc. For this the marks obtained in B.Sc. Part one B.Sc.
Part two and B.Sc. Part three will be jointly considered :-
-
Internal text is
compulsory :- On graduate level there will be two internal tests.
First internal test will be from the first three units of the syllabus . Its
weightage will be 80% in the second internal test concerned teacher will
include the remaining two units for 20% weightage and do the total evaluation
of the students. To be eligible for the main examination the student must
appear in the first internal test or its retest in all the subjects. The
students who remain absent in the first internal test will not be eligible for
the main examination. The total obtained marks of the two internal test will
be added to main examination on the basis of 30% proportionate
weightage.
If a student goes to attend a
programme after being nominated by the principal and so in unable take the
internal test , or due to some extra ordinary circumstances a student in
unable to appear in the inter test. For such students after the principal's
order a special internal test can be arranged. For this the student will have
to deposit extra fees. The case of extra ordinary circumstances will be
decided by a committee set up by the principal.
The internal test marks of ex.
Students will remain as before and their main examination with be on the basis
of current session syllabus. Such students will have no eligibility to appear
in the next session examination as ex- private
candidates.
Post Graduate
Examination Scheme :
M.Sc. Examination will be arranged by
semester system. Two year syllabus is divided in four semesters. Examination
will be arranged in each semester for theory and practical
syllabus.
In theory examination 20%
marks will be for internal test and 80% marks for semester main examination.
The method of internal test will be decided by the head of the concerned
department. It is expected that the students would understand the system and
form of the internal test from their heads of the departments, it will be the
responsibility of the students. For appearing in every semester examination
regular students will have to appear at least in one complete internal test
other wise they will be not eligible for the semester examination. There will
be Two internal tests in a semester. It is compulsory to pass theory and
practical examinations separately. In practical examination like a theory
examination the students will have eligibility to pass and carry.
Minimum passing marks are 36% for
second division minimum marks are 48% and for the first class 60% marks are
compulsory. The division will be decided on the basis of marks obtained in
theory, practical and internal test marks after the fourth semester
To Pass The
Examination :-
-
In every question paper minimum
20% and 36% of all the question paper's total marks are compulsory.
-
In semester theory main
examination 36% marks must be obtained and joing total of theory and internal
test also must be 36%.
-
It a student obtains 36% of the
total marks but in some paper gets less than 20% marks such student will not
be declared pass. In the paper that he secured less than 20% marks he will
have to carry the paper in the partial examination. Such student will be
studying in the next semester as a regular student will have to appear in the
main as well as in the partial examination compulsorily. Partial examination
will be held with next semester examination. If a students is declared
eligible to appear in the first semester text then he will have to appear in
the partial examination with the theory examination of the second semester
programme as declared by the institution. This arrangement will be applicable
to the remaining semester examinations.
-
If a student obtains less than
20% marks in two papers he will be declared fail. Such fail student will have
to appear as ex-student in the full examination according the declared time
table of the examination. He will have to appear in the examination according
to the syllabus taught at the time for the semester. It will be the
responsibility of the ex-student to know about the current syllabus.
-
If a student get 20% or more
marks in every theory question papers is 36% but total of internal and theory
marks is less than 36% the student will be declared as fail . Such students
will be eligible to appear in the next session examination as ex-students. The
internal test marks of such student will be as before.
-
If a student gets 20% or more
marks in every Theory question paper and the total marks of theory question
paper is 36% but the total of internal and theory marks is less than 36% the
student will be declared as tail such students will be eligible to appear in
the next session on as ex-students . The internal text marks of the student
will be as before.
Some
Other Points :
-
In the degree and postgraduate
main examinations maximum two answer books can be re-valued.
-
Revaluation is not allowed for
internal test, practical supplementary, and Carry examinations.
-
In semester scheme no student
will be allowed t o carry more than one question paper.
-
No student will be allowed to
reappear in full or partial examination to improve marks, percentage or
division.
-
Details
-
Three grace marks can be given
on graduate level to pass the examination. To improve division one mark can
be given as special grace mark. No student can get the advantage of the two
kinds of grace marks.
-
On post graduate level one
grace mark can be given to pass or improve the division. No student can get
the advantage of the two kinds of grace marks.
-
The advantage of grace mark
will not be given for deciding the merit order.
-
For the degree or interim degree
the competent officer of the D.A.V.V. will have to be contacted.

Supplementary Examination
:- A student will be permitted supplementary examination only in one
subject at the graduate level. In case the student fails ever in the
supplementary examination or fails in more than one subject in the final
examination he will have to appear in all the papers of the same class as an
ex-student in the next academic session. Ex-students are required to seek
guidance regarding the arrangement of practicals from the concerned head of
the department. It is responsibility of the ex-students to obtain information
about the dates of the practical examination. For eligibility to appear in the
examination, the ex-students must get themselves registered on / before 14 th.
August.
